Skoda Kushaq facelift expected to launch in Q1, 2026 It will come with cosmetic design and interior Major tech upgrades could include LEVEL 2 ADAS, new infotainment unit No changes under the hood
First Launched in 2021, the Skoda Kushaq has been one of the best-selling models for the Czech automaker in India. The SUV is now due for a mid-life updated, and the facelifted model has already been spotted on the roads. The spy images reveal that the 2026 Skoda Kushaq facelift will receive cosmetic design changes and major tech upgrades, while the mechanics will remain the same.
Skoda is currently testing the Kushaq facelift and high chances that its launch could take place in the fag end of 2025 or in the first quarter of 2026. Not just Kushaq, the Skoda Slavia sedan will also receive a mid-life upgrade. Kushaq’s German cousin, the VW Taigun will also receive a mid-life update sometime in 2026.
The 2026 Skoda Kushaq will continue to rival the likes of the Hyundai Creta, Kia Seltos, Honda Elevate, Maruti Suzuki Grand Vitara and the upcoming Maruti Escudo and the Renault Duster.

The Kushaq facelift won’t receive changes to body panels, and the changes will be cosmetic in nature. It is likely to get a revised front grille and headlamp set-up. The spy images reveal that the 2026 Skoda Kushaq facelift will get a slightly slimmer front grille with slats, redesigned headlamps with a connected daytime running lights, and a new fog lamp housing.
At the back, the 2026 Skoda Kushaq facelift is likely to get revised tail-lamp set-up. It is expected to get connected tail-lamps, which seems inspired by the new Kodiaq. Other changes could include new bumpers, and newly designed alloy wheels.
The cabin images are yet to hit the Internet, but it is expected to receive new upholstery for seats and new trims. The SUV could also receive an upgraded version of the touchscreen infotainment unit with wireless Android Auto and Apple CarPlay support.
The big tech upgrade will come in the form of LEVEL-2 ADAS. The ADAS tech will offer features like ad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assistance, autonomous emergency braking, traffic sign recognition, forward collision warning and others.
In terms of features, the Kushaq facelift will continue to be offered with a fully digital color instrument cluster, a two-spoke steering wheel, an auto-dimming IRVM, and ventilated seats.
It is yet to be confirmed whether Skoda will add panoramic sunroof to Kushaq facelift. We believe that Kushaq’s top-end variant could get panoramic sunroof while the single-pane sunroof could trickle down to mid-level variants.
The Skoda Kushaq facelift will continue to be offered with the existing 1.0-litre TSI petrol and a 1.5-litre TSI petrol engines. While the former is good for 115hp and 178Nm of torque, the bigger unit produces 150hp and 250Nm of torque. The 1.0L engine will be paired to either a 6-speed manual or a 6-speed torque converter automatic gearbox, while the 1.5L turbo unit will get a 7-speed DCT automatic unit. Skoda could offer a manual gearbox with the bigger 1.5L turbo petrol engine as well.
